Sarah Dupree - Louisiana 

Sarah Dupree is a Louisiana based multidisciplinary artist using mixed media to explore the divine through subconscious exploration and the investigation of contemporary ethics. She was born in Guatemala City, Guatemala and was brought home to a large loving Christian family in the United States. Her mother, a librarian and father, a veterinarian, homeschooled her throughout middle school and high school, which gave her the time and space to cultivate creative ambitions. 
Dupree has since received her BFA in Studio Art and minored in Art History with Louisiana Tech University's School of Design. Her work has appeared in many local shows as well as both national and international exhibitions. In recent years, she has worked as a Special Projects coordinator for Creative Exchange and the Ross Lynn Foundation, as well as working part time as a print assistant at Fine Line Supply Co. Her collection of works titled “Echos in the Dreamscape” continues to grow and she is expanding her work to include various mediums and extensive research into politics and ethics.
